Prince Kodua

Dr. Prince Kodua was appointed as a lecturer in 2007 in the department of Marketing and Entrepreneurship, University of Ghana Business School. Since his appointment, he has taught various subjects and supervised several undergraduate and graduate level research projects including the Executive MBA. He has also held a Visiting Scholar position with the University of North Texas, in the United States of America. The Researcher has also published in a number of international journals including the International Journal of Law and Management, and the African Journal of Business and Economies. In addition, Dr. Kodua has won several research grants and has presented papers in a number of international conferences including the prestigious Academy of Marketing Science. Prior to becoming a lecturer the researcher who is also a blessed and an astute entrepreneur, held various senior managerial positions in airline, telecommunications, and real estate companies. Dr Kodua has also been involved in several high profile research and consultancy projects for various institutions including the British Council, Ghana. His research interest is wide and diverse but currently focusing on corporate social responsibility, branding, marketing communications and consumer behaviour in developing country context.
